The Mechanics of Slot Machines
Slot machines are often perceived as simple devices, yet their inner workings are anything but straightforward. Each machine operates using a Random Number Generator (RNG), a sophisticated algorithm that generates a sequence of numbers at lightning speed. This technology ensures that every spin is independent of the last, meaning previous outcomes have no impact on future results. Common Myths About Slot Machines
One pervasive myth surrounding slot machines is the belief that they have hot and cold streaks. Players often think that if a machine hasn’t paid out in a while, it is “due” for a win. This misconception ignores the RNG mechanism, which ensures each spin is entirely independent. As a result, past performance does not influence future results. The randomness of outcomes means that any perceived streaks are merely coincidences, not indicators of future payouts.
Another common myth is that players can improve their odds with specific strategies or techniques. Some believe that timing their bets or observing patterns can lead to better outcomes. However, this is not supported by the underlying technology of the machines. The RNG functions continuously, meaning there is no beneficial timing strategy to exploit. Players should not waste their time searching for patterns, as each spin remains unpredictable and random, reinforcing the idea that luck plays a pivotal role in the outcome.
Additionally, many players think that higher denomination machines offer better odds compared to lower ones. While it can be true that some high-stakes slots may have higher payout percentages, this is not a universal rule. Each machine is programmed with its own return-to-player (RTP) percentage, independent of the denomination. It’s vital for players to research and understand each machine’s specifics rather than assuming higher bets equate to better returns. The Role of Return to Player Percentage
Return to Player (RTP) is a crucial concept in understanding how slot machines function. R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ine is programmed to return to players over time. For example, a machine with an RTP of 95% will theoretically return $95 for every $100 wagered, although this is calculated over a significant number of spins and not on individual sessions. Therefore, players should carefully consider RTP when selecting which games to play, as this can influence their long-term experience.
Moreover, it’s important to note that RTP does not guarantee a consistent payout for every player or every session. The RTP percentage is an average calculated over thousands or millions of spins, meaning that short-term results can deviate significantly. Players can experience substantial losses over a series of spins, even on a machine with a high RTP. The Psychology Behind Slot Machines
The design of slot machines is carefully crafted to maximize player engagement and enjoyment. Understanding the psychology behind these devices helps explain why many fall prey to misconceptions about randomness. Features like flashy graphics, enticing sounds, and near-miss scenarios create an illusion of control and influence over the game outcomes. This can lead players to believe they can predict or manipulate results, despite the reality of the RNG. Recognizing these psychological triggers can help players maintain a more rational approach to gaming.
Additionally, the phenomenon known as “losses disguised as wins” can further confuse players. Slot machines often celebrate small wins with celebratory sounds and visuals, even if a player leaves with less than what they initially wagered. This can create a false sense of achievement and lead individuals to feel as though they are winning when, in reality, they are losing. Such incentives can blur the distinction between genuine wins and losses, promoting the idea that luck is more favorable than it truly is, and encouraging longer play sessions.
Winning can also trigger a release of dopamine, a chemical associated with pleasure and reward, reinforcing the desire to keep playing. This psychological feedback loop encourages players to return to the machines, even when they logically understand the randomness of outcomes.
